  • Abstract
    Artificial Intelligence planning systems determine a sequence of actions to be taken to solve a problem. This is accomplished by generating and evaluating alternative courses of action. A special type of Petri net is first defined and then used to model a class of Artificial Intelligence planning problems. A planning strategy is developed using results from the theory of heuristic search. In particular, the A* algorithm is utilized. From the Petri net framework it is shown how to develop an admissible and consistent A* algorithm. As an illustration of the results three Artificial Intelligence planning problems are modelled and solved.
